What Are Calcium, Magnesium, and Vitamin D?

Calcium: The Bone Builder

Calcium is the most abundant mineral in our bodies, primarily found in our bones and teeth. It plays a vital role in various bodily functions, including muscle contractions, blood clotting, and nerve signaling. Approximately 99% of the calcium we consume is stored in our bones, where it helps maintain their structure and strength.

Recommended Intake

The recommended daily intake of calcium varies by age and gender:

  • Men and Women (ages 19-50): 1,000 mg
  • Women (ages 51 and older): 1,200 mg
  • Men (ages 71 and older): 1,200 mg

Magnesium: The Hidden Hero

Often overshadowed by calcium, magnesium is another critical mineral that assists in over 300 biochemical reactions within our body. It helps convert food into energy, supports muscle and nerve function, is essential for the production of proteins, and plays a role in regulating calcium levels.

Recommended Intake

The recommended intake for magnesium is as follows:

  • Men (ages 19-30): 400 mg
  • Men (ages 31 and older): 420 mg
  • Women (ages 19-30): 310 mg
  • Women (ages 31 and older): 320 mg

Vitamin D: The Sunshine Vitamin

Vitamin D is not just a vitamin but a hormone that our bodies produce in response to sunlight. It plays a crucial role in calcium absorption and bone health. Without sufficient vitamin D, our bodies cannot effectively utilize calcium, leading to weakened bones and increased risk of fractures.

Recommended Intake

The daily recommendations for vitamin D are:

  • Adults up to age 50: 400-800 IU
  • Adults aged 51 and older: 800-1000 IU

The Synergy of Calcium, Magnesium, and Vitamin D

Together, calcium, magnesium, and vitamin D work synergistically. Vitamin D enhances calcium absorption in the intestines, while magnesium aids in converting vitamin D into its active form. This dynamic trio is crucial for maintaining bone health and preventing disorders like osteoporosis.

Benefits of Supplementing with Calcium, Magnesium, and Vitamin D

Bone Health

The most well-known benefit of these three nutrients is their significant role in promoting strong bones. Research shows that adequate calcium and vitamin D intake can reduce the risk of osteoporosis, especially among postmenopausal women and older adults.

Muscle Function

Magnesium is essential for muscle function, ensuring that our muscles can contract and relax appropriately. This is vital not only for physical performance but also for preventing muscle cramps and spasms.

Immune Support

Vitamin D plays an important role in supporting our immune system. It has been linked to a lower risk of infections and autoimmune diseases. A sufficient intake of vitamin D can thus contribute to better overall health.

Cardiovascular Health

Studies indicate that magnesium may help regulate blood pressure, reducing the risk of cardiovascular disease. Moreover, vitamin D supports heart health by influencing blood flow and vascular health.

Enhanced Mood and Mental Well-being

Emerging research suggests that vitamin D and magnesium can play roles in mood regulation. Low levels of either have been associated with feelings of depression and anxiety, making supplementation a potential complementary approach to mental health.

Choosing the Right Supplements

Factors to Consider

When choosing a calcium, magnesium, and vitamin D supplement, it's important to consider several factors to ensure you're making the best decision for your health:

1. Formulation

Different forms of calcium supplements, such as calcium carbonate and calcium citrate, have different absorption rates. While calcium carbonate is more widely available and less expensive, calcium citrate is often better absorbed, especially for individuals with low stomach acid.

2. Dose

The elemental form of these minerals matters—this is the actual amount available for absorption by the body. Always check the label for the elemental content per serving.

3. Absorption

The absorption of minerals can be influenced by other dietary factors. For instance, calcium is best absorbed when consumed in smaller doses with food, typically not exceeding 500 mg at a time.

4. Tolerability

Some mineral supplements can cause digestive side effects such as gas and constipation. Magnesium can sometimes have a laxative effect, so trial and error may be necessary to find the right form and combination that suits you.

FAQ

1. How do I know if I need a calcium, magnesium, and vitamin D supplement?

If you suspect your dietary intake is insufficient due to lifestyle, dietary restrictions (like vegetarianism or lactose intolerance), or if you have specific health concerns, a supplement can help fill gaps. Consulting a healthcare professional is advisable for personalized advice.

2. What is the best time of day to take these supplements?

Generally, calcium and magnesium are best taken in smaller doses with meals to enhance absorption, while vitamin D can be taken at any time, although some prefer it in the morning attached to breakfast.

3. Can I take these supplements if I am pregnant or breastfeeding?

Many prenatal supplements include these nutrients; however, always check with a healthcare provider before starting any new supplement during pregnancy or lactation.

4. Are there any side effects of taking calcium, magnesium, and vitamin D supplements?

Possible side effects can include digestive upset, constipation, or diarrhea, particularly with magnesium. Monitoring your body's response and consulting a healthcare provider for persistent issues is essential.

5. How can I maximize the benefits of my supplements?

For optimal benefits, maintain a balanced diet rich in whole foods, monitor your intake of calcium and vitamin D from all sources, and consider combining supplements with lifestyle practices such as adequate sleep and exercise.
